375B.02 DEFINITION.
"Subordinate service district" means a compact and contiguous district within the county in
which one or more governmental services or additions to countywide services are provided by the
county and financed from revenues secured from within that district. The boundaries of a single
subordinate service district may not embrace an entire county.
History: 1982 c 507 s 9
